About

Located in Cass Lake, Minnesota, Leech Lake Tribal College (LLTC) is a two-year tribal college best known for seamlessly integrating Anishinaabe (Ojibwe) language, culture, and values into a supportive academic environment. The college’s strongest academic pathways include associate degrees in Indigenous Leadership, Forest Ecology, and Liberal Arts with an Anishinaabe Studies emphasis, all designed to prepare students for local careers or seamless transfer to four-year institutions. On campus, you will experience a close-knit, family-like community where small class sizes foster deep mentorship and student life is enriched by cultural ceremonies, traditional arts, and community gatherings. What truly sets LLTC apart is its dual identity as a land-grant institution utilizing the surrounding Chippewa National Forest as a living laboratory, combined with an educational philosophy anchored in the Seven Grandfather Teachings.


Wikipedia:Leech Lake Tribal College (LLTC) is a public tribal land-grant community college in Cass Lake, Minnesota. It was established in 1990 and designated a land-grant college in 1994. The college includes approximately 70 faculty, staff, administrators, and 250 students. Most students come from the Leech Lake and Red Lake Reservations, and approximately 8% of the student population consists of non-Indian students.
